About the Role
As an integral member of the Burger King Team, the Restaurant General Manager (RGM) has overall responsibility for managing daily operations of a single restaurant (10-45 employees), ensuring delivery on guest satisfaction, and ensuring desired restaurant outcomes (i.e., increased sales, profitability, and employee retention). The RGM leads the restaurant management team and oversees financial controls, operations, people development, guest service, and BKC compliance within the restaurant across all shifts. This position is overseen by a District Manager (DM) and directly manages Team Members, Shift Coordinators, and Assistant Managers. The RGM interacts with restaurant team members, restaurant management, DMs, customers, members of the field operations team, and outside vendors.
The RGM should be able to work long and/or irregular shifts, including extra shifts, as needed, for the proper functioning of the restaurant.
